Attachment Mods
Amino, thiol, acrydite, and phosphate groups incorporated during synthesis allow post synthesis reactions for attaching a variety of labels or for coupling the oligo with other molecules.

Quenchers
Quenchers are most commonly paired with specific fluorophores and are chosen based on their ability to absorb energy at the emission wavelength of the fluorophore.

Spacers
Spacers form a non-binding bridge between areas of an oligo. Among our offerings are C3 spacer which can substitute for an unknown base and Spacer 18 which introduces a hydrophobic area in an oligo.

Biotins
Biotin offers a variety of uses in research including assays in drug discovery, histological, and cytological applications and capture methods are based on the high affinity of biotin for avidin and streptavidin.
